Output 7b5f10256104c648e849d55ae0cf28ee600becadafb998e9a164896d8bf92a9c:3

value
163354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dad508a622bbd901df340e3b90b2117f3ee38bc OP_EQUAL
address
3Ec8phgLqMzCZpZTnboSC1pDUAG1z53WW8
transaction
7b5f10256104c648e849d55ae0cf28ee600becadafb998e9a164896d8bf92a9c
spent
true